The Ethane,1,1,2,2-tetrafluoro-1-methoxy-, with CAS registry number 425-88-7, belongs to the following product category: refrigerants. It has the systematic name of 1,1,2,2-tetrafluoro-1-methoxyethane. And its IUPAC name is the same one. What's more, its EINECS is 207-039-4.
Physical properties of Ethane,1,1,2,2-tetrafluoro-1-methoxy-: (1)ACD/LogP: 0.91; (2)# of Rule of 5 Violations: 0; (3)ACD/LogD (pH 5.5): 0.91; (4)ACD/LogD (pH 7.4): 0.91; (5)ACD/BCF (pH 5.5): 2.88; (6)ACD/BCF (pH 7.4): 2.88; (7)ACD/KOC (pH 5.5): 74.24; (8)ACD/KOC (pH 7.4): 74.24; (9)#H bond acceptors: 1; (10)#H bond donors: 0; (11)#Freely Rotating Bonds: 2; (12)Polar Surface Area: 9.23 Å2; (13)Index of Refraction: 1.272; (14)Molar Refractivity: 18.27 cm3; (15)Molar Volume: 106.6 cm3; (16)Polarizability: 7.24×10-24cm3; (17)Surface Tension: 12.7 dyne/cm; (18)Enthalpy of Vaporization: 24.75 kJ/mol; (19)Vapour Pressure: 1280 mmHg at 25°C.
Uses of Ethane,1,1,2,2-tetrafluoro-1-methoxy-: it can be used to produce difluoroacetyl fluoride and fluoromethane. This reaction will need solvent neat (no solvent). The yield is about 88%.
When you are using this chemical, please be cautious about it as the following:
The Ethane,1,1,2,2-tetrafluoro-1-methoxy- is extremely flammable, so keep it away from sources of ignition. This chemical is toxic by inhalation, in contact with skin and if swallowed. You should keep its container in a well-ventilated place and take precautionary measures against static discharges. This chemical also irritates to eyes, respiratory system and skin. When use it, wear suitable protective clothing, gloves and eye/face protection. If contact with eyes, rinse immediately with plenty of water and seek medical advice. In case of accident or if you feel unwell, seek medical advice immediately (show the label whenever possible.)
You can still convert the following datas into molecular structure:
(1)SMILES: FC(F)C(F)(F)OC
(2)InChI: InChI=1/C3H4F4O/c1-8-3(6,7)2(4)5/h2H,1H3
(3)InChIKey: YQQHEHMVPLLOKE-UHFFFAOYAF
(4)Std. InChI: InChI=1S/C3H4F4O/c1-8-3(6,7)2(4)5/h2H,1H3
(5)Std. InChIKey: YQQHEHMVPLLOKE-UHFFFAOYSA-N
